Fred Oien, athletic director and head of the Department of Health, Physical Education and Recreation, is retiring.

Oien has held his current positions for 18 years and has served SDSU athletics since 1979. Oien plans to retire April 8, 2009.

In a press release, SDSU President David Chicoine said the university’s transition to NCAA Division I athletics will be Oien’s legacy at SDSU.

“Fred has been a driver of the very successful Division I move, despite all the challenges it presented,” Chicoine said. “His leadership was essential. Our athletic teams have competed for conference championships in many sports, and student athletes have participated in team and individual national competitions.”
